Texans to boost ticket prices

The Chronicle's John McClain reports that Texans ticket prices are going up:

After not raising ticket prices in 2006, the Texans announced Friday they are increasing the average ticket price by $2.88 this year.

The average ticket price for the 2007 season will be $60.63, an increase of about 5 percent, according to John Schriever, Texans vice president for ticketing and event management.

[snip]

"I think a lot of our fans believe that we've turned the corner because we won four more games in Gary (Kubiak's) first season," Schriever said.

Right. There's no doubt that's what a lot of fans are thinking (as opposed to, "They drafted WHOM with the first pick last year?").
